ASKARI is a classical style boat with accommodation for 10 guests in five well-appointed staterooms. With special features such as a wet bar, a Jacuzzi and an impressive range of water toys, including kayaks, paddel boards and water-skis guests are sure to make wonderful lifelong memories on board. ASKARI, the Swahili world meaning 'guard' has explored some of the most remote corners of the globe and is available to charter in the South Pacific.
